The newly-elected president of main opposition party New Democracy Kyriakos Mitsotakis has arranged a series of meetings with prominent party officers, as part of his pledge to reorganize the conservative party.

On Wednesday morning Mr. Mitsotakis met with his sister Dora Bakoyanni. Prior to the meeting Mrs. Bakoyanni appeared on Mega Channel and announced that she will do anything the new party leader requests.

Mr. Mitsotakis met with Apostolos Tzitzikostas – who was also a candidate in the first round of New Democracy’s elections – around noon and is scheduled to meet Makis Voridis at 13:30.

On Tuesday the New Democracy president met with former PM and party leader Kostas Karamanlis, amid rumors of tension over his support for Evangelos Meimarakis. Mr. Mitsotakis also met with former PM and party leader Antonis Samaras.
